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bad-smelling Alkanet | Phoma blight |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Fungi (Fungi)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Ascomycota (Sac Fungi)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Dothideomycetes (Dothideomycetes) |
| Order | Boraginales (Boraginales) | Pleosporales (Pleosporales) |
| Family | Boraginaceae | Didymellaceae |
| Genus | Alkanna | Epicoccum |
| Species | Alkanna maleolens | Epicoccum sorghinum |
